In short: Launceston Mayor Danny Gibson says recent media reports about his Working With Vulnerable People status have taken a toll on his mental health. 

What's next: Danny Gibson says he will resign formally on Tuesday but will stay on as a councillor. 

The mayor of Tasmania's second-largest city is resigning, citing a toll on his mental health following "vile attacks, stemming from media reports".

Danny Gibson, 39, said he had made the "difficult decision" to step down as the Mayor of Launceston.

Mr Gibson was first elected to the council in 2011, taking up the mayoral role last year.

He is also a former Tasmanian Young Australian of the Year.

In early April this year, the ABC reported that Mr Gibson's Working with Vulnerable People (WWVP) status was under review.
